| #include <libradiocompat/RadioResponse.h> |
| |
| #include "commonStructs.h" |
| #include "debug.h" |
| #include "structs.h" |
| |
| #include "collections.h" |
| |
| #define RADIO_MODULE "DataResponse" |
| |
| namespace android::hardware::radio::compat { |
| |
| namespace aidl = ::aidl::android::hardware::radio::data; |
| |
| void RadioResponse::setResponseFunction(std::shared_ptr<aidl::IRadioDataResponse> dataCb) { |
| mDataCb = dataCb; |
| } |
| |
| std::shared_ptr<aidl::IRadioDataResponse> RadioResponse::dataCb() { |
| return mDataCb.get(); |
| } |
| |
| Return<void> RadioResponse::allocatePduSessionIdResponse(const V1_6::RadioResponseInfo& info, |
| int32_t id) { |
| LOG_CALL << info.serial; |
| dataCb()->allocatePduSessionIdResponse(toAidl(info), id);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::cancelHandoverResponse(const V1_6::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->cancelHandoverRes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::deactivateDataCallResponse(const V1_0::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->deactivateDataCallRes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::getDataCallListResponse(const V1_0::RadioResponseInfo& info, |
| const hidl_vec<V1_0::SetupDataCallResult>&) { |
| LOG_CALL << info.serial; |
| LOG(ERROR) << "IRadio HAL 1.0 not supported"; |
| return {}; |
| } |
| |
| Return<void> RadioResponse::getDataCallListResponse_1_4( |
| const V1_0::RadioResponseInfo& info, const hidl_vec<V1_4::SetupDataCallResult>&) { |
| LOG_CALL << info.serial; |
| LOG(ERROR) << "IRadio HAL 1.4 not supported"; |
| return {}; |
| } |
| |
| Return<void> RadioResponse::getDataCallListResponse_1_5( |
| const V1_0::RadioResponseInfo& info, |
| const hidl_vec<V1_5::SetupDataCallResult>& dcResponse) { |
| LOG_CALL << info.serial; |
| dataCb()->getDataCallListResponse(toAidl(info), toAidl(dcResponse)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::getDataCallListResponse_1_6( |
| const V1_6::RadioResponseInfo& info, |
| const hidl_vec<V1_6::SetupDataCallResult>& dcResponse) { |
| LOG_CALL << info.serial; |
| dataCb()->getDataCallListResponse(toAidl(info), toAidl(dcResponse)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::getSlicingConfigResponse(const V1_6::RadioResponseInfo& info, |
| const V1_6::SlicingConfig& slicingConfig) { |
| LOG_CALL << info.serial; |
| dataCb()->getSlicingConfigResponse(toAidl(info), toAidl(slicingConfig)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::releasePduSessionIdResponse(const V1_6::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->releasePduSessionIdRes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setDataAllowedResponse(const V1_0::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->setDataAllowedRes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setDataProfileResponse(const V1_0::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->setDataProfileRes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setDataProfileResponse_1_5(const V1_0::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->setDataProfileRes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setDataThrottlingResponse(const V1_6::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->setDataThrottlingRes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setInitialAttachApnResponse(const V1_0::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->setInitialAttachApnRes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setInitialAttachApnResponse_1_5(const V1_0::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->setInitialAttachApnRes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setupDataCallResponse(const V1_0::RadioResponseInfo& info, |
| const V1_0::SetupDataCallResult&) { |
| LOG_CALL << info.serial; |
| LOG(ERROR) << "IRadio HAL 1.0 not supported"; |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setupDataCallResponse_1_4(const V1_0::RadioResponseInfo& info, |
| const V1_4::SetupDataCallResult&) { |
| LOG_CALL << info.serial; |
| LOG(ERROR) << "IRadio HAL 1.0 not supported"; |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setupDataCallResponse_1_5(const V1_0::RadioResponseInfo& info, |
| const V1_5::SetupDataCallResult& dcResponse) { |
| LOG_CALL << info.serial; |
| dataCb()->setupDataCallResponse(toAidl(info), toAidl(dcResponse)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::setupDataCallResponse_1_6(const V1_6::RadioResponseInfo& info, |
| const V1_6::SetupDataCallResult& dcResponse) { |
| LOG_CALL << info.serial; |
| dataCb()->setupDataCallResponse(toAidl(info), toAidl(dcResponse)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::startHandoverResponse(const V1_6::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->startHandoverResponse(toAidl(info)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::startKeepaliveResponse(const V1_0::RadioResponseInfo& info, |
| const V1_1::KeepaliveStatus& status) { |
| LOG_CALL << info.serial; |
| dataCb()->startKeepaliveResponse(toAidl(info), toAidl(status)); |
| return {}; |
| } |
| |
| Return<void> RadioResponse::stopKeepaliveResponse(const V1_0::RadioResponseInfo& info) { |
| LOG_CALL << info.serial; |
| dataCb()->stopKeepaliveResponse(toAidl(info)); |
| return {}; |
| } |
| |
| } // namespace android::hardware::radio::compat |
